• Resistors are electronic components which have a specific, never-changing electrical resistance. The resistor’s resistance limits the flow of electrons through a circuit. They are passive components, meaning they only consume power (and cant generate it). Resistors are usually added to circuits where they complement active components like op-amps, microcontrollers, and other integrated circuits. Commonly resistors are used to limit current, divide voltages, and pull-up I/O lines.

    A potentiometer is a manually adjustable variable resistor with 3 terminals. Two terminals are connected to both ends of a resistive element, and the third terminal connects to a sliding contact, called a wiper, moving over the resistive element. The position of the wiper determines the output voltage of the potentiometer. The potentiometer essentially functions as a variable voltage divider. The resistive element can be seen as two resistors in series(potentiometer resistance), where the wiper position determines the resistance ratio of the first resistor to the second resistor. A potentiometer is also commonly known as a potentiometer or pot. The most common form of potmeter is the single turn rotary potmeter. This type of pot is often used in audio volume control (logarithmic taper) as well as many other applications. Different materials are used to construct potentiometers, including carbon composition, cermet, wirewound, conductive plastic or metal film.

    The IC CD4026 is an IC which can perform the function of both a counter as well a 7-segment Driver. One single IC can be used to count form zero (0) to nine (9) directly on a Common Cathode type 7-segment display. The count can be increased by simply giving a high clock pulse; also more than one digit (0-9) can be created by cascading more than one CD4026 IC. So if you have a 7-segment (CC) display on which you have to display numbers that are being counted based on some condition then this IC will be a perfect choice.

  • A heat-sink is designed to remove heat from a transistor and dissipate it into the surrounding air as efficiently as possible. Heat-sinks take many different forms, such as finned aluminium or copper sheets or blocks, often painted or anodised matt black to help dissipate heat more quickly. Good physical contact between the transistor and heat-sink is essential, and a heat transmitting grease (heat-sink compound) is smeared on the contact area before clamping the transistor to the heat-sink.

    This is a 32.768 MHZ Crystal. This is a low cost crystal oscillator with oscillation frequency of 32.768 MHZ. Crystal are normally required to provide clock pulses to your micro-controller or other ICs which require external clock source. An oscillator crystal has two electrically conductive plates, with a slice or tuning fork of quartz crystal sandwiched between them. The crystal oscillator circuit sustains oscillation by taking a voltage signal from the quartz resonator, amplifying it, and feeding it back to the resonator. Quartz has the further advantage that its elastic constants and its size change in such a way that the frequency dependence on temperature can be very low.

    The BT139 is a TRIAC thyristor, which is a type of semiconductor device that can use to control alternating current (AC) power. TRIAC thyristor BT139 is a four-quadrant device, meaning that it can conduct current in either direction. The BT139 has a peak inverse voltage (PIV) of 800 volts and a current rating of 16 amperes. It is a sensitive gate triac, meaning that it can be triggered with a low gate current. The on-state voltage drop of the BT139 is 1.2 volts. Here are some of the key features of the BT139-800E 4 Quadrant TRIAC:

    • Peak inverse voltage (PIV): 800 V
    • RMS current: 16 A
    • Gate trigger current: 2.5 mA
    • Gate trigger voltage: 1.4 V
    • On-state voltage drop: 1.2 V
    • Thermal resistance: 1.2 K/W (junction to mounting base)
    • Operating temperature range: -40 to 125 °C

  • The CD4081 quad gate is a monolithic complementary MOS (CMOS) integrated circuit constructed with N- and P-channel enhancement mode transistors. They have equal source and sink current capabilities and conform to standard B series output drive. The devices also have buffered outputs which improve transfer characteristics by providing very high gain. All inputs protected against static discharge with diodes to VDD and VSS.
